Description

2-Bromo-3-(3-Cyanophenyl)-1-Propene is a versatile brominated aromatic intermediate featuring both a reactive bromoalkene group and a cyano substituent. This unique bifunctional structure makes it a valuable building block for the synthesis of complex organic molecules, particularly in pharmaceutical and agrochemical research. It is primarily sought after by R&D chemists and process development scientists working on novel active ingredients and advanced materials. The compound, with CAS number 731772-71-7, is supplied to meet the stringent purity requirements of modern chemical synthesis.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: Key precursor in the synthesis of potential drug candidates, especially those targeting central nervous system (CNS) disorders or as kinase inhibitors.
  • Agrochemical Synthesis: Used in the development of novel herbicides, fungicides, and insecticides, leveraging its halogen and nitrile functionality.
  • Ligand and Catalyst Development: Serves as a starting material for creating specialized phosphine ligands or metal-organic frameworks (MOFs).
  • Material Science Research: Building block for polymers and advanced organic electronic materials due to its conjugated system potential.
  • Cross-Coupling Reactions: The bromoalkene moiety is amenable to various palladium-catalyzed cross-coupling reactions (e.g., Suzuki, Heck) for carbon-carbon bond formation.
  • Chemical Biology Probes: Used to create tagged molecules or activity-based probes for studying biological pathways.

Basic Information

Item Detail
Product Name 2-Bromo-3-(3-Cyanophenyl)-1-Propene
CAS No. 731772-71-7
Molecular Formula C10H8BrN
Molecular Weight 222.08 g/mol
Synonyms 3-(3-Cyanophenyl)-2-bromoprop-1-ene; 1-(2-Bromoallyl)-3-cyanobenzene; 2-Bromo-3-(3-cyanophenyl)prop-1-ene; m-Cyanophenyl-2-bromoallyl; (3-Cyanophenyl)-2-bromoallyl; 2-Bromoallyl-3-cyanobenzene; 3-(2-Bromoallyl)benzonitrile

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ated place at a controlled room temperature (15-25°C). Keep away from strong acids and incompatible organic solvents. For long-term storage, consider storing under an inert atmosphere to maintain optimal stability.
